Quote #157905
My grandma’s the most careful, safe driver in the world. You put her in a rental car, and she’s doing doughnuts in the K-Mart parking lot!
Jeff Foxworthy

Interpretation
The joke hinges on a sudden reversal of expectations. Foxworthy begins with a familiar, affectionate stereotype—an elderly grandmother as an exceptionally cautious driver—then undercuts it by suggesting that the anonymity and low personal stakes of a rental car unleash reckless behavior. The image of “doing doughnuts” in a K-Mart parking lot exaggerates the contrast for comic effect, pairing a mundane, everyday setting with a flashy act of automotive bravado. More broadly, it riffs on how people’s behavior can change when responsibility feels diluted (it’s not “my” car), and how family narratives about relatives can be both idealized and ripe for playful subversion.
